Free

Everybody loves free!

Resource type
Cost
Skill level
Certificate

try his method too

In this article, I'll explain why podcasts replaced a lot of my Wikipedia usage for informal learning. Ill also talk about how I listen to 5+ hours of podcasts every day.

the Codeland Developer Conference

Our mission: to help people learn to code for free. We accomplish this by creating thousands of videos, articles, and interactive coding lessons - all freely available to the public. We also have thousands of freeCodeCamp study groups around the world.

Enchanting Marketing

Earn 50 project management education hours towards your PMP (Project Management Professional) certification and exam when you complete Cornell's Project Management certificate program.

eMarketing Institute _�_ Web Analytics Course

The beginning of the course is focused on explaining what web analytics is, how it all started, and how analytics changed over the years with the development of technology. You will also learn about true potential of web analytics and how you can use it to help your business grow.

Free Accounting Courses (edX)

Take online accounting courses from top institutions like Columbia, Maryland, New York Institute of Finance, and more. Learn about accounts payable, debits and credits, cash flow statements, revenue recognition, the accounting cycle, bank reconciliation, accounts receivable, accounting concepts, and more with online courses.

Core Java Tutorial-Learn Step by Step with Example

You will learn the key features of the language and develop skills in Java programming. The core java development course teaches you how to use the major application areas of Java, including GUI development, applets, database applications using JDBC and distributed object computing.

A Basic MySQL Tutorial

MySQL is an open source database management software that helps users store, organize, and retrieve data. It is a very powerful program with a lot of flexibility'this tutorial will provide the simplest introduction to MySQL

The Docker Ecosystem

The Docker project has given many developers and administrators an easy platform with which to build and deploy scalable applications. In this series, we will be exploring how Docker and the components designed to integrate with it provide the tools needed to easily deliver highly available, distributed applications.

Scaling Django

Django is a Python-based platform for building modern web apps. As with any platform, issues can arise with your need to scale and expand your user base. In this tutorial series, we will go over several strategies and best practices for scaling your Django app in a reliable, stable way.

Introduction to Git: Installation, Usage, and Branches

This series covers the installation and usage of git on an Ubuntu 14.04 server. After completing the series, the reader should feel comfortable installing and using git, as well as how to create two branches (master and develop) and how to merge code from the development stage to production.

Getting Started with Linux

This tutorial covers getting started with the terminal, the Linux command line, and executing commands. If you are new to Linux, you will want to familiarize yourself with the terminal, as it is the standard way to interact with a Linux server.